  13. With 5 jumps, I don't know a great deal about skydiving, but I do know basic economics. Here's the deal: Bill is not "hoarding" the technology, as you put it. He is GETTING PAID for it. Anyone that innovates to the benefit of the world at large deserves to be well rewarded for the hard work, intellect, and risk involved in said innovation. If the Skyhook is the life saver that it appears to be, I hope that Bill is richly, and more importantly, conspicuously rewarded. What the sport needs is for the industry to see innovation being rewarded. That would be incentive for the rest of the industry to innovate as well. One of those future innovations might be the next technology that almost eliminates fatalities from the sport. To quote Adam Smith: "It is not from the benevolence of the butcher, the brewer, or the baker that we get our lunch, but from their self interest." If Bill gives away the Skyhook with the lofty intent of saving lives, the end result would be suppression of future innovation, possibly the biggest innovation the sport has ever seen.
